    It is not illegal and is actually the sensible thing to do.

    Imagine you were moving home.
    There are are set times to move fruit trees and canes, potatoes and onions may already be in the ground, psb cropping away and so on.
    No-one would expect you to give all those up.

    It is common practice to keep both plots the first year in order to harvest and move crops at the proper season.
